What is the primary focus of plumbing codes in Massachusetts?

The primary focus of plumbing codes in Massachusetts is health and safety standards. Plumbing codes are established to protect public health by ensuring that plumbing systems are designed and installed correctly to prevent contamination of the water supply, safeguard against plumbing failures, and ensure proper sanitation.

These codes dictate various aspects, such as the materials that can be used, installation practices, and maintenance procedures, all aimed at minimizing health risks. For instance, codes specify how to prevent backflow, which can lead to serious health hazards if contaminated water enters the potable water supply.

While environmental impact plays a role in modern plumbing considerations, and aesthetic design and construction speed may influence project decisions, the foremost priority of plumbing codes is always to protect individuals and communities by maintaining safe and hygienic plumbing practices.
